So far this month Washington has had over a foot of snow and the frost has gone deep into the ground. Washington Maintenance and Construction Superintendent J.J. Bell states that the frost has been between 24 and 36 inches deep, which is contributing to water main breaks.

On average, the City of Washington has about 22 breaks annually, but there have been 23 already this year in just two months. Bell says that anyone needing to report a break can call the maintenance and construction department at 653-2947.
